Bit of a mystery problem and i have to get it sorted by noon!

I have a PC with onboard Sigmatel audio. Apparently the sound just stopped working. The driver is installed ok and all looks good in device manager.

http://i36.tinypic.com/ju7szq.jpg


But there is no volume control. In CP/sound and audio devices both the "mute" and "place volume icon in the taskbar" are greyed out".

http://i37.tinypic.com/wwgmmx.jpg

If i try and run sndvol32.exe direct i get a "there are no mixer devices available please install one etc..."

But if i go to DM and open the Sigmatel C-major audio device and click on properties it is showing a mixer device installed.

http://i38.tinypic.com/233axt.jpg


I have check the the windows audio service is running

Any ideas?
